Arrest over garden fight stabbing

A man has been arrested in connection with an incident in Carlisle in which a 25-year-old suffered stab wounds.

Police were called to Lediard Avenue in the Currock area of the city on Tuesday night after reports of a disturbance.

A man from Wigton was injured when a fight broke out in a garden. He was taken to hospital but his injuries are not thought to be life-threatening.

Police arrested a 27-year-old man on suspicion of assault and grievous bodily harm with intent.
